Purpose
Encode a string with MIME base64
Syntax
BASE64_ENCODE(<expC>)
See Also
Description
The BASE64_ENCODE() function is used to encode a character string with MIME base64.
The BASE64_DECODE() function is used to decode back to the string.
Example
// Write encoded password to a file m_pass=space(10) @10,10 get m_pass read strtofile(base64_encode(m_pass),"password.txt")
